I am a Professor of Psychology at Baruch College and the Graduate Center of CUNY, with a Ph.D. from UC Berkeley in industrial/organizational, social, and personality psychology. I supervise PhD students, teach executive programs, and run an active research lab. I am also an executive coach, consultant, and public speaker.
Before academia, I worked in the airline industry, was a member of a diplomatic corps, and lived as an expatriate across cultures. Those experiences are part of how I understand organizations and the people in them.
My academic training and research inform my work in practice. For over twenty-five years I have studied how emotions shape behavior at work: envy, jealousy, fear of leading, and what happens when people feel they have been treated unfairly. I also study unconscious influences on decision-making, organizational fairness, and how people experience and respond to change. I apply that work directly in coaching sessions, consulting engagements, and executive education. The research does not stay in the lab.

I work with senior executives on leadership effectiveness, career development, navigating organizational complexity, and career transitions.
My coaching draws on my research: how emotions, power dynamics, interpersonal processes, and unconscious patterns shape how leaders think, decide, and relate to others. I work with clients on the specific situations they face, whether that is leading through change, managing difficult relationships, or preparing for a new level of responsibility.
I work with executives privately and as a contracted executive coach at the McNulty Leadership Program at the Wharton School, University of Pennsylvania, and at the Leadership Lab at Columbia Business School.
Hogan Assessments certified.
I work with leaders and organizations on the human side of organizational challenges: understanding what is driving behavior, and supporting leaders through periods of change and complexity.
My approach to change draws on my research on emotions, fairness, and how people actually experience organizational transitions. Most organizations plan for the logistical side of change. My work focuses on the human side, including reactions that are often overlooked or misunderstood.
I speak at conferences, corporations, and executive education programs on topics drawn from my research and teaching. Topics include the psychology of organizational change, emotional intelligence at work, organizational fairness and justice, envy and other emotions in the workplace, and leadership psychology.
I design and deliver workshops and multi-day programs for leadership teams and organizations, built around the specific challenge or question the organization is facing.
